The Three Pillars of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

ecommerce-USA-client-local-SEO-and-commercial-SEO.pngSearch engine optimization packages engines offer users content that is relevant to their queries. This information can be in the form text videos, images or even suggestions.

The ranking of pages is determined by sophisticated algorithms that take into consideration a variety of factors. Some of these include the popularity of the website linking to as well as the relevance of the topic and trust in the website.

Keywords

Keywords are the primary focus of any search engine optimization campaign. They aid you in understanding the way your visitors search for a product or service, and help you organize the content on your website. Keywords can range from simple words to complex phrases, and they can be utilized to increase relevant organic traffic to your site.

When choosing SEO keywords, it is important to select those that are relevant to you and your business. They should also have a significant search volume. However, you must be aware of keyword competition -the greater the demand for a particular keyword is, the more the competition. You can use tools such as Google's Adwords Keyword Planner or SEMRush to identify the most effective keywords for your business.

One of the most important aspects of selecting the most appropriate keywords is to make sure that they are aligned with the intentions of your customers. For instance, if a person typed in a keyword that is transactional, such as "buy," into a search engine, they're probably looking to purchase something or navigate to a sales page. If a customer types in "neon blue unisex watch" on the other hand they could be searching for information or a price comparison.

It is important to identify keywords by trial and error. A bad choice of keywords can lead to poor performance on your site and decrease conversions. In the beginning, it's crucial to understand the different kinds of keywords and their definitions.

WordStream's free keyword tool is one of the tools that will assist you in identifying the most effective keywords for your website. The tool will provide you with the list of keywords that are likely to bring new traffic to your site. You can also narrow your search by filtering the results by industry and country.

Once you've determined the ideal keywords, you can begin writing content. Choose 1-4 key words per page of your website that are a perfect balance of relevancy, search volume, and difficulty. Then, look for semantically related and long-tail modifying words that could assist in supporting the primary keywords. Also, ensure that your keywords are aligned to the funnel of marketing or the customer journey in order to target your audience.

On-page optimization

On-page optimization, while it is not the only one of the three pillars of SEO, is the most direct and fundamental method of improving rankings. It involves applying keyword research to the content of web pages and making sure they provide a relevant answer to search queries. This is achieved by using both semantic keywords and relevant page content.

If executed correctly, can boost organic traffic and increase the visibility of search engines. It can also help businesses establish their brand online and increase the possibility for conversions. SEO on-page can be carried out for free and yield quick and tangible results.

To be able to implement on-page SEO, a business must first determine the most relevant keywords and topics for its website. This can be accomplished by a variety of methods, such as studying competitors and conducting keyword research using tools such as Ahrefs and AnswerthePublic. Once the keywords are identified and researched, they should be integrated as naturally as you can into the page's content. The content on the page should be written for the target audience and should include both long- and short-tail keywords. It should also be organized in a way that makes it easy for search optimization engines to navigate and index. This can be accomplished by reducing duplicate content and ensuring that footers and navigation menus don't have too many levels.

After having completed the on-page SEO an organization should conduct a review of the site to assess its performance. This can be accomplished manually or with the help of a tool. The audit should highlight any errors and prioritize them according to their impact on the quality of the page. The most serious errors must be addressed first, as they have the greatest impact on the page's rankings. Then, fresh ideas gleaned from competitors must be implemented to further improve the page's performance.

On-page optimization is one of the most cost-effective digital marketing strategies. In contrast to paid advertising, it requires only a small investment in time and resources. In addition, it can provide an excellent return on investment. It's important to be aware that the benefits of optimizing your website can be eroded over time due to algorithm changes. It is essential to stay up with the latest Google updates.

Off-page optimization

Off-page optimization is a marketing strategy that is performed outside of the website to increase its visibility on organic search engine result pages (SERPs). While on-page SEO is primarily focused on the technical aspects of a site, off-page SEO includes a variety of promotional strategies. These include link-building as well as social media marketing.

Off-page SEO is crucial as it builds authority and credibility and is essential to a website's position in organic results in search engines. It can also be utilized to increase brand recognition and increase traffic. Additionally, off-page SEO can be used to drive conversions and sales.

You can improve the performance of your website using various methods, such as social media marketing and guest blogging. The key is to concentrate on your intended audience and the type of content they like reading. This will ensure that your website is visible to the people who are the most interested in it.

In addition, off-page SEO could help you rank higher in search engines by increasing the number of links to your website. This is because search optimisation engines view the number of links on your site as a vote of confidence for your website. It is due to this that a mega-source like as Wikipedia can rank so highly in results of a search.

While both on-page and off-page SEO are important, they should not be seen as competing with one another. It's like deciding whether or not to install a car engine or tires in it - both are necessary to ensure that the car functions correctly. Therefore, it's important to prioritize on-page SEO and correct any errors prior to focusing on off-page SEO tactics.

Local businesses that have physical locations, off-page SEO could also include local marketing campaigns designed to get online reviews and traffic. This can be as simple as putting up a sign in your shop's window, asking for reviews, or as complex as creating an event that leads to online reviews and social media posts. In fact, Google has even filed patents on how branded search queries can be used similarly as links to connect an organization with a search query to give it a higher ranking in search results.

Link building

Link building is a key element of SEO strategies. It involves making other websites link to your site and the quality of these links can have an impact on search engine rankings. Google analyzes the quality and quantity of linked to its website to determine a page's relevance. A page with more links is therefore deemed more valuable than one with fewer links.

To boost your SEO, you must focus on creating high-quality content and gaining high-quality backlinks. However, it's important to keep in mind that not all backlinks are created in the same way. A link from the New York Times, for instance, is more useful than a blog that is niche. The reason behind this is that large sites are more likely to have greater authority and are regarded as trustworthy by their readers. This is why you should try to get links from authoritative websites in your field or niche.

Avoid using unethical tactics for building links, such as purchasing links or taking part in link exchanges. These methods are known as black hats, and they can hurt your ranking over time. Additionally, they may cause a penalty from Google and may cause your website to be removed from their search results.

There are a variety of ways to build quality links, including guest blogging and sending your content to directories. You can also post your content on social media with potential linkers. Finally, you can contact influencers to ask them to link to your website. Be cautious not to overdo it since too many backlinks can affect your rankings.

It is also recommended to be careful not to link to pages that have irrelevant anchor text. It's best to let the site that links to you decide how it would like to refer to your content, since this will help Google comprehend the context of the link, and ensure that the resultant link is relevant. Google will also assess the words around the hyperlink to determine whether they're related or affect the quality of search results for a referencing page.
